Previously published as Echo of a Distant Drum. From the Dust Jacket: "Here is the first comprehensive volume of [Winslow] Homer's Civil War art to be published. [It] includes virtually his entire artistic production from 1861 to 1865 in all mediums - oils, drawings, watercolors, wood engravings, and lithographs, superbly reproduced and accompanied by battle maps, contemporary photographs. illuminating commentaries. [The] battleground became both his school and his studio. At first he thrilled to the drama and heroism of battle, depicting what he saw with great realism, but as the agony dragged on, he recoiled from the scenes of death and turned to life among the men in camp, with its moments of humor, camaraderie, and boredom. His art brought the look and feel of the war home to his countrymen. Although Homer accompanied the Union army and presented the war from the Northern viewpoint, he perceived the tragedy inherent in civil warfare and portrayed both victor and vanquished with sympathy and dignity." Winslow Homer, who became the USA's greatest 19th century artist, came to manhood at the time of the Civil War, and has provided a unique, eye-witness account of the conflict as a result. Previously published as 'Echo of a Distant Drum: Winslow and the Civil War', the book is a comprehensive pictorial history of the war as Homer saw it, and includes virtually all his artistic production between 1861 and 1865, in all mediums - oils, drawings, watercolours, wood engravings and lithographs.
